SSS disrupts importers' security outfit in Ilorin
Men of the Kwara State command of the State Security Services (SSS) have vowed to continue preventing security task force of the Importers Association of Nigeria (IMAN) from carrying out any operation in the state.
The Nigerian Tribune gathered that men of the SSS, who stormed the venue of a seminar/training programme of the IMAN task force at the state Hajj Camp, Adewole Area of Ilorin, in a commando style, prevented officials of the organisation from registering over 400 applicants who had besieged the venue for the programmme.
It was also gathered that the state security outfit, that came in large number to the venue in jeeps and heavily armed, locked all the buildings meant for the planned programme since Monday, alleging that the importers’ security outfit was illegal and fake.
Some of the applicants with their luggage, who said they had travelled from neighbouring states, added that they were assaulted by the state security outfit when they tried to enter the venue of the programme.
Speaking with the Nigerian Tribune, the state Director of the task force, Mrs. Omoyemi Abiona, explained that IMAN is legally backed by Article 21 of its constitution to set up a task force to combat increasing rate of smuggling of goods, small arms and light ammunition from our borders into the country.
Abiona appealed to the National Assembly and President Goodluck Jonathan to intervene in the matter by processing the bill setting up the task force to stop undue harassment.
She said that the task force had been successfully set up in North, South-East, South-South and Oyo State, adding that there was no reason for alleged intimidation in the state.
Efforts made to speak with the SSS director in the state, proved abortive as he was said not to be available for comments the Nigerian Tribune visited the SSS office.
